Once Brindlecast is deployed behind the Fennmark balancer, the /healthz endpoint needs to return 200 within two seconds or the node gets yanked from rotation. Don't skip this: the balancer retries twice, then marks the node dead for five minutes, which looks exactly like an outage. The health check handler verifies it can reach the session store, so the app needs the store's auth material at boot. Pop open the service's env file and add the session store credential on its own line.

secret setting of hawep-yahig: LEDGER_TOKEN29=41b5d6315371c92885eaeb077fb63

- [ ] Step 7: Archive cold storage buckets (Glacierline tier). Confirm both ceremony witnesses are present, verify bucket manifests match the Oxbow ledger, then seal the archive key shares. Plugin authors may observe but not handle shares. Once sealed, the archive index itself is encrypted and can only be reopened with the passphrase below.

vault phrase of badup-hahig = tamael-aldael-kelmir-istael-fenok-istwyn-tamius-jorath-oliion

Handover for the Linwood Annex wellness room: bookings run through the slate outside the door, half-hour slots, contractors welcome between 10:00 and 15:00. Please wipe down the mats after use and leave the dimmer at its marked setting. Kerrin from the Halloway team checks the slate each morning. To unlock the wellness room door itself, enter the pass code that follows.

staff pass of kawip-hawef = bdg-QLP-2

// REINDEX_BATCH_CAP limits docs per shard pass in the Tallowfield
// nightly search reindex. Raising it starves the ingest queue;
// lowering it overruns the maintenance window. 5000 is the tested
// sweet spot. Change only with a soak run. Verified against the
// build noted below.

session token of bawif-hahog = htk6_ac5981